Output d6a3870ddde2a3330c4a76259b2e4fdadd6b6cb7485827d5592454ef79848ea7:1

value
45303352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d04a66fd0c93d4180d660ddb46322df24b560cc3 OP_EQUAL
address
MStVutmBEDhHKEiZLUWSoaXVKhiZ7etJoj
transaction
d6a3870ddde2a3330c4a76259b2e4fdadd6b6cb7485827d5592454ef79848ea7
spent
true